To power on the Midland XT511 radio, ensure it is charged or has fresh batteries, then turn the power/volume knob clockwise until you hear a click. The radio will emit a beep and the display will light up.

The Midland XT511 can be charged using the included AC adapter or DC car charger. Connect the adapter to the radio and plug it into a power source, then allow it to charge fully.
The weather alert feature on the XT511 provides automatic updates and alerts from NOAA weather channels. It informs you of severe weather conditions in your area.
Yes, the Midland XT511 has a built-in hand-crank and USB port that allows it to charge small devices like smartphones in emergency situations.
To reset the Midland XT511 to factory settings, turn off the radio, then press and hold the Mode and Scan buttons simultaneously while turning it back on.
A continuous tone may indicate that the radio is too close to another radio or device, causing feedback. Move the radios apart and ensure they are on different frequencies or channels.
To lock the keypad, press and hold the Lock button until the lock icon appears on the display. This prevents accidental changes to settings.
If the display screen is blank, check the battery or power source. Ensure the radio is turned on and that the display contrast is not set too low.
